1. General Description
2. Basic Specifications
Applicable system: YASNAC I80 / I80M (requires FC250/FC251 CPU board)
Backplane: JANCD‑FC001 (standard I80 backplane, 1 slot)
Board size: Full‑length (≈267 × 140 mm, same as FC410/FC310)
Power supply: DC 24V ±10%, approx. 1.5 A
Operating temperature: 0 to +45°C
Storage temperature: −20 to +60°C
Revision: Final revision A02
3. I/O Configuration (High‑Density)
Inputs (IN): 96 points
Signal level: DC 24V, sink/source selectable (NPN/PNP compatible)
- 用途:Limit switches, proximity sensors, pushbuttons, E‑stop, tool sensors, clamps, pallets
Response time: ≤1 ms
Outputs (OUT): 96 points (transistor)
Voltage: DC 24V, max 0.5 A per point
- 用途:Solenoids, relays, indicators, alarms, cylinders, motor start signals
Protection: Self‑resetting fuse per point, overload/short‑circuit protection
Connectors
CN42: I/O terminal block (96IN / 96OUT, screw terminals, 3 rows)
CN20: System bus (to backplane, communication with FC250/FC251)
LEDs: Power, bus status, IN/OUT channel status for diagnostics
4. FC420 vs FC410 vs FC400
| Item | FC420 (High‑Density) | FC410 (Expansion) | FC400 (Standard) |
|---|---|---|---|
| I/O points | 96IN / 96OUT | 64IN / 64OUT | 32IN / 32OUT |
| Board size | Full‑length | Full‑length | Half‑length |
| I/O density | Very high | High | Medium |
| Max per system | 1 board | 2 boards | 2 boards |
| Typical use | 5‑axis, large machines, auto lines | Mid‑size machines | Standard lathes/machining centers |
5. System Compatibility & Combinations
Mandatory pairing
CPU board: JANCD‑FC250 (standard) or FC251 (high‑grade)
Backplane: JANCD‑FC001
Recommended configurations
High‑density setup: FC251 + 1×FC420 (max I/O for I80)
Mixed setup: FC251 + FC420 + FC400 (128IN/128OUT total)
Axis boards: FC300B (3‑axis feed), FC310 (spindle)
Limitations
Cannot be used standalone (depends on FC250/FC251 for power and bus)
Occupies 1 full slot on FC001 backplane
I80 system limit: 1×FC420 maximum (due to high bus load)
6. Common Faults & Alarms
A.420 Bus error: CN20 loose, backplane contact failure, bus chip fault
No input signals: CN42 wiring loose, 24V supply fault, input channel burnout
Outputs not activating: Overload/short circuit, load fault, wiring error
All LEDs off: Backplane 24V missing, internal fuse blown
Partial channel failure: Terminal block oxidation, bent pins, internal trace damage
7. Applications
Large 5‑axis machining centers (massive I/O for clamps, pallets, tools)
Multi‑station transfer machines (high sensor/actuator count)
Automated production lines (machine + material handling + inspection)
High‑end turn‑mill centers (dual spindle + multiple turrets)
Legacy machine upgrades (max I/O expansion without full CNC replacement)
